Who am I

I am a Solicitor specialising in serious international injury and complex cross-border litigation. I bring a decade of experience in international personal injury work, having spent my career handling cases involving foreign jurisdictions, complex liability issues and overlapping legal frameworks. I now focus on helping clients who have suffered life changing injuries abroad navigate a process that can feel unfamiliar and overwhelming.

My team

I am part of a specialist team handling complex international injury claims. We regularly work with frameworks such as the Package Travel Regulations, the Montreal Convention and the Athens Convention. Each team member brings different strengths, and by working closely together we keep even the most technical cross-border cases clear and manageable for clients.
